Nuova Simonelli Aurelia Wave Espresso Machine Repair
The Nuova Simonelli Aurelia Wave is a flagship commercial espresso machine that combines elegance, advanced technology, and exceptional performance for high-volume coffee operations. Successor to the Aurelia II, the Wave model features a striking design with LED lighting, programmable volumetric dosing, Soft Infusion System (SIS), and options for EZ Cream automatic milk frothing. Chosen for World Barista Championship events, it represents Nuova Simonelli’s commitment to precision, reliability, and barista-friendly operation in demanding environments.
Available in semi-automatic, volumetric, Digit, and T3 configurations across 2, 3, and 4 group models, the Aurelia Wave offers large boilers, powerful steam wands, and customizable features like self-cleaning cycles and adjustable hot water systems. Its heat exchanger or multi-boiler setups (in T3) deliver outstanding temperature stability and recovery time, enabling consistent espresso quality and rapid drink production even during peak hours. The machine’s robust construction and intuitive controls make it a top choice for specialty cafes and busy establishments.

Common Repair Issues
The Nuova Simonelli Aurelia Wave, built for intensive commercial use, can encounter issues related to its complex electronics and high workload. Common problems include pressurestat failures leading to inconsistent boiler pressure and temperature fluctuations. Pump-related faults, such as intermittent operation or failure to engage, can reduce brew pressure and affect shot quality. Control board relays and electronic components may wear, causing power issues, unresponsive buttons, or error codes on Digit and touchscreen models.
Steam and water system leaks are frequent due to thermal stress on gaskets, o-rings, and solenoids. Group head leaks, steam wand dripping, and hot water dispenser problems often arise from worn seals or scale buildup. In high-volume settings, drain system blockages and vacuum breaker issues can lead to overflows or leaks. Temperature stability problems in multi-boiler T3 versions may require sensor or heating element attention.
Additional typical concerns for the Aurelia Wave involve scale accumulation affecting flow restrictors and infusion systems, lighting failures, and wear on volumetric dosing components. These issues can impact consistency, efficiency, and safety if not addressed by qualified technicians.
